A Gigabyte of Prevention Is Worth a Pound of Unemployment

Woman sitting at laptop using social mediaWhat does this catch phrase even mean, youre probably wondering?!… It is pretty simple actually: GOOGLE YOURSELF BEFORE A JOB INTERVIEW!!!  

I know that we all have fabulous, fun-filled, realistic lives outside of the workplace, and that we live in a society where we are constantly snapchatting, instagraming, facebooking, tweeting, pinning, etc… But what we tend to forget is that the man is in fact watching! The manbeing your potential new employer- who is entering your name into a search engine before you even show up to put your best professional foot forward, and to no surprise, guess what they see? You and your friends using your laps as a dance floor for a very attractive scantily clad woman or man, while smoking what looks to be a very “odd-smelling” cigarette! Ok, calm down, maybe thats not your life, Im just judging you. (Hey, so are “they”!)

I think you get the point. Its all about perception, as you never know what someone will be thinking when they see your over-documented lifestyle and trust me- theyre judging a lot more then you know, and their opinions go straight to the top!! Why blow an interview before you even walk in the door?!

My advice, protect yourself… LOCK IT DOWN! Set your privacy settings toNO ONE can view me anywhere. EVER. This absolutely goes for anyone seeking a new position but even for all of you who assume your job is safe. DONT. HR, your current boss and even your co-workers are watching and judging the life you live. Value your integrity and privacy. Sure its your first amendment right to post whatever you please, but its also a sure way to get fired or NOT HIRED.
